dc.description.abstractNowadays different cases of allergy in different clothes have been observed due to organic components used in industrial preparation of garments. Mainly, these compounds are usually dyes although it is also possible to find other related compounds of the industrial processes such as preservatives. An analytical methodology to detect the presence 15 of organic compounds with potentially allergenic properties in Personal Protective Equipment (PPE) has been developed. Samples previously homogenized in a cryogenic mill, were introduced into a Py-GC/MS. With this methodology, the presence of a potential allergen (benzyl benzoate) in some of the new clothes analyzed could be detected and, simultaneously, the presence of dyes would be also discarded. Moreover, the disappearance of this compound in the contaminated PPE was confirmed after a washing treatment.es
